Little to no power? by ElectronicShirt5651 in subaru

[–]DreadSwizzard 0 points1 point  (0 children)

Check your timing, the plug on the right kinda looks like you may have a small misfire that's not enough to set a code. Is it shaking when running? Other things could be fuel quality, black flakey plugs are due to carbon buildup which could be due to burning oil and could also suggest valves sticking open.

Spark plugs. by CelebrationOk6536 in AskAMechanic

[–]DreadSwizzard 0 points1 point  (0 children)

Just a heads up but the old one looks to be an iridium tip plug and the new one is a nickel plated plug according to the part number and that might cause your engine to run rough and also won't last as long as the factory plugs. Some engines are more sensitive to specific plugs than others so just be aware that it may cause issues. Different plug types can create different flame fronts in the cylinder and that can lead to different combustion characteristics and possibly misfires. Not saying it'll happen in your car but I've seen it happen before especially with cheap plugs or champion plugs in a Japanese engine...
